  • How Tax Incentives Drive the Film Industry
    Jul 26 2024

    Send us a Text Message.

    George Ford with the Phoenix Center for Advanced Legal and Public Policy Studies discusses film tax incentives and their effectiveness in attracting business to states.

  • No More Chevron Deference: Analyzing Loper Bright and Corner Post
    Jul 19 2024

    Send us a Text Message.

    Tax Notes contributing editor Marie Sapirie discusses the recent Supreme Court decisions overturning Chevron and defining the statute of limitations period and their potential impact on the future of tax litigation.

  • The SALT Cap After 2025
    Jul 12 2024

    Send us a Text Message.

    Ted Peterson of the University of North Texas Ryan College of Business discusses the SALT deduction cap and its potential paths forward as the 2025 sunset date approaches.
